## Authentication

Stockpath, the vending-machine restock planner, authenticates against the internal Crateline inventory service. All route-planning calls send a bearer token in the `Authorization` header; tokens are minted at startup from a static service key. Note for review: the key now loads from config, not the old hardcoded constant — please verify no fallback remains. Integration tests run against the Crateline staging tier using the key below.

gateway credential: zpat15_lMLOSdhT94y0U3l

## Artifact Signing — TilePrefetch

TilePrefetch (the map-tile prefetcher in Cartelle) ships as a signed tarball. Release manager signs after CI green, never before. Verify the manifest digest matches the build log, then sign on the airgapped box in the Norvik rack. No exceptions for hotfixes. All downstream mirrors verify against the public signing key below.

rollout seal: bky19_GLHMhzUtYPr4jkbQawL

- [ ] Step 7: Archive cold storage buckets (Glacierline tier). Confirm both ceremony witnesses are present, verify bucket manifests match the Oxbow ledger, then seal the archive key shares. Plugin authors may observe but not handle shares. Once sealed, the archive index itself is encrypted and can only be reopened with the passphrase below.

vault phrase of badup-hahig = tamael-aldael-kelmir-istael-fenok-istwyn-tamius-jorath-oliion

**Key ceremony checklist — item 4 (TilePilot prefetcher)**

Before we rotate the signing keys for the TilePilot map-tile prefetcher, double-check that the prefetch queue on the Brindlewood cluster is fully drained. Nobody wants half-fetched tiles signed with the old key — ask Marnie how that went last quarter. Once drained, two ceremony witnesses from the Atlas Guild team confirm the HSM slot, and the old material gets escrowed. Then, and only then, record the recovery passphrase for the escrow bundle below.

vault phrase of kawep-tahog = ulaix-briath